About the course
The Master of Fine Arts is a research degree that supports advanced development of your art practice through supervised independent study. Delivered by Sydney College of the Arts, you pursue studio-led research and written work in one or more discipline areas, guided by a specialist supervisor. You’ll undertake a substantial research project culminating in a thesis and/or an examined body of creative work. This is a Masters by research in visual arts. The programme delivers postgraduate depth in theory, applied practice, and professional standards for specialist career progression.
Career outcome
Graduates may pursue careers as independent artists and creative practitioners, or progress into roles connected to contemporary art production, curation and arts organisations. The research focus also supports pathways into further higher degree research, teaching in art and design contexts, and practice-led roles in cultural institutions, festivals and creative industries. Outcomes reflect advanced capability in research, critical inquiry and studio practice at Masters level in visual arts.
